THE WELFARE OF THE CITY
Juanita Campbell Rasmus understands the power of service. She is a speaker, writer, spiritual director, and contemplative teacher; and has been the co-pastor of the St. John’s United Methodist Church in downtown Houston with her husband, Rudy, since 1992. Her book, “Learning to Be: Finding Your Center After the Bottom Falls Out”, offers spiritual practices to discover new ways of being. Pastor Juanita serves her community by facilitating meals, housing and empowerment for the homeless. She teamed up with Tina Knowles Lawson and Beyoncé to help forty thousand flood victims recover in the wake of Hurricane Harvey. How can serving your community make a difference? Just listen to Pastor Juanita who advocates that, “The universe is inviting us to live our most expansive lives. Don’t play it small!”
